Farrah Fawcett Dies of Cancer at 62
After a courageous and lengthy battle with cancer, Farrah Fawcett died Thursday morning. She was 62.
Her spokesman, Paul Bloch, said she died at 9:28AM at the St. John’s Health Center in Santa Monica, Calif.
At the 62-year-old actress’s bedside her longtime partner Ryan O’Neal and actress pal Alana Stewart.
Farrah, best known as one of TV’s Charlie’s Angels, was diagnosed with anal cancer back in September 2006.
